    Fully Learnable Front-End for Multi-Channel Acoustic Modeling using Semi-Supervised Learning

    Full text link
    In this work, we investigated the teacher-student training paradigm to train a fully learnable multi-channel acoustic model for far-field automatic speech recognition (ASR). Using a large offline teacher model trained on beamformed audio, we trained a simpler multi-channel student acoustic model used in the speech recognition system. For the student, both multi-channel feature extraction layers and the higher classification layers were jointly trained using the logits from the teacher model. In our experiments, compared to a baseline model trained on about 600 hours of transcribed data, a relative word-error rate (WER) reduction of about 27.3% was achieved when using an additional 1800 hours of untranscribed data. We also investigated the benefit of pre-training the multi-channel front end to output the beamformed log-mel filter bank energies (LFBE) using L2 loss. We find that pre-training improves the word error rate by 10.7% when compared to a multi-channel model directly initialized with a beamformer and mel-filter bank coefficients for the front end.     Modernization, Life Course, and Marriage Timing in Indonesia

    Get PDF
    Past research on marriage timing in Asia has found the modernization framework to be insufficient for explaining and understanding the processes of marriage and non-marriage. Using insights provided by research on marriage timing in Western societies, we examine the determinants of marriage and non-marriage for Indonesian men and women using the 1993 and 1997 waves of the Indonesian Family Life Survey dataset. Using a logit and a hierarchical model we examine the characteristics of unmarried men and women at time 1 who had married by time 2. We find that the basic correlates of the process of industrialization - education and work-force participation have counter-intuitive associations with marriage. While level of education does nothing to delay marriage, being enrolled in school keeps people away from marriage. Work force participation in contrast increases the odds of people's marriage while earnings from work have no effect. Based on our results we argue that the processes of marriage and non-marriage are best understood using a life course perspective. The life course perspective examines how the social context that people live in influences their lives, and determines their life trajectories, and the choices they make. Seen from this perspective, events such as marriage are a part of a person's life course that follows a normative sequence. People get married at that stage in their life when they are considered ready for it. When they are in school they are viewed as minors who are not suited to starting and raising a family whereas people who are working are viewed as adults who have the stability to take on the responsibilities of a married life

    Energy Efficiency: Opportunities, Challenges, and Potential Solutions

    Full text link
    Energy efficiency undertakings create cost savings and public benefits. These cost savings provide owners/managers with opportunities to earn a return on their investments. Benefits include lower electricity congestion, lower emissions, and potentially lower prices. However, there are many cases in which viable projects are known but not pursued. This research seeks to asses the role of capital markets in driving investment into non-residential building energy efficiency. Research Questions: What are the demand-side and supply-side measures that could save the most energy at the least cost? What are the impediments to investment in these measures? What are potential solutions, particularly in terms of financial instruments, products, and structures? Methodology: Secondary research In-depth interviews Conferences / trade shows Findings: Investment in non-residential building energy efficiency is taking place but not to the extent possible. When projects do attract customer attention, access to capital is a significant issue, not least because of the difficulty in collateralizing EE equipment, and most ESCOs’ lack of credit ratings. Utilities are looking to establish authoritative and lucrative positions, driven by new regulation.     Inflammation-Induced Oxidative Stress Mediates Gene Fusion Formation in Prostate Cancer.

    Get PDF
    Approximately 50% of prostate cancers are associated with gene fusions of the androgen-regulated gene TMPRSS2 to the oncogenic erythroblast transformation-specific (ETS) transcription factor ERG. The three-dimensional proximity of TMPRSS2 and ERG genes, in combination with DNA breaks, facilitates the formation of TMPRSS2-ERG gene fusions. However, the origins of DNA breaks that underlie gene fusion formation in prostate cancers are far from clear. We demonstrate a role for inflammation-induced oxidative stress in the formation of DNA breaks leading to recurrent TMPRSS2-ERG gene fusions. The transcriptional status and epigenetic features of the target genes influence this effect. Importantly, inflammation-induced de novo genomic rearrangements are blocked by homologous recombination (HR) and promoted by non-homologous end-joining (NHEJ) pathways. In conjunction with the association of proliferative inflammatory atrophy (PIA) with human prostate cancer, our results support a working model in which recurrent genomic rearrangements induced by inflammatory stimuli lead to the development of prostate cancer

    The global retinoblastoma outcome study : a prospective, cluster-based analysis of 4064 patients from 149 countries

There is some evidence to suggest that major differences exist in treatment outcomes for children with retinoblastoma from different regions, but these differences have not been assessed on a global scale. We aimed to report 3-year outcomes for children with retinoblastoma globally and to investigate factors associated with survival. METHODS : We did a prospective cluster-based analysis of treatment-naive patients with retinoblastoma who were diagnosed between Jan 1, 2017, and Dec 31, 2017, then treated and followed up for 3 years. Patients were recruited from 260 specialised treatment centres worldwide. Data were obtained from participating centres on primary and additional treatments, duration of follow-up, metastasis, eye globe salvage, and survival outcome. We analysed time to death and time to enucleation with Cox regression models. FINDINGS : The cohort included 4064 children from 149 countries. The median age at diagnosis was 23·2 months (IQR 11·0–36·5). Extraocular tumour spread (cT4 of the cTNMH classification) at diagnosis was reported in five (0·8%) of 636 children from high-income countries, 55 (5·4%) of 1027 children from upper-middle-income countries, 342 (19·7%) of 1738 children from lower-middle-income countries, and 196 (42·9%) of 457 children from low-income countries. Enucleation surgery was available for all children and intravenous chemotherapy was available for 4014 (98·8%) of 4064 children. The 3-year survival rate was 99·5% (95% CI 98·8–100·0) for children from high-income countries, 91·2% (89·5–93·0) for children from upper-middle-income countries, 80·3% (78·3–82·3) for children from lower-middle-income countries, and 57·3% (52·1-63·0) for children from low-income countries. On analysis, independent factors for worse survival were residence in low-income countries compared to high-income countries (hazard ratio 16·67; 95% CI 4·76–50·00), cT4 advanced tumour compared to cT1 (8·98; 4·44–18·18), and older age at diagnosis in children up to 3 years (1·38 per year; 1·23–1·56). For children aged 3–7 years, the mortality risk decreased slightly (p=0·0104 for the change in slope). INTERPRETATION : This study, estimated to include approximately half of all new retinoblastoma cases worldwide in 2017, shows profound inequity in survival of children depending on the national income level of their country of residence. In high-income countries, death from retinoblastoma is rare, whereas in low-income countries estimated 3-year survival is just over 50%.
